The familiarity of a mouse with the convenience of a trackball. Designed for comfort in either hand, this space-saving trackball boasts Logitech's innovative optical tracking system to deliver superior precision and smooth motion with virtually no maintenance or cleaning required.
Fits Like a Mouse, Works Like a Trackball
• Durable optical technology for smooth precision and resistance to dirt,
eliminating the need for cleaning
• Large, finger-operated trackball for superior control and reduced hand and
wrist movement
| | • Sleek shape flexible enough to use in either hand
• Two ways to scroll: click two small buttons for page up and page down, or
click one of two large buttons and use the ball for auto-scrolling
• Three-year warranty
• MouseWare® Software included
Easy scrolling on the web, in Windows® and Macintosh® applications:
A variety of button assignments to customize your mouse
buttons.

 | System Requirements for PC : |
 | IBM®-compatible PC |
 | Windows® 95, Windows® 98, Windows® NT, Windows® 2000, Windows® Me, Windows® XP |
 | Available USB or PS/2 port |
 | Windows® 98 or later for USB |
 | CD-ROM drive |
 | System Requirements for Macintosh : |
 | Macintosh® OS 8.6 or later |
 | USB port |
 | CD-ROM drive |
